    Do you have jetted bathtubs?

    Thank you asking Mike. We do not have an onsite hotel, and we, therefore, do not have bathtubs available for our guests. To see the conference amenities we do offer, please visit https://andersonconferencecenter.com/.

    I started planning my wedding in March 2019, though I had venues in mind long before that. The…read moreLibrary Ballroom had always been on my list due to it's gorgeous architecture and location. So I packed up my then fiance and we took a day trip down there in May 2019! Kaylee gave us a tour, answered all of our questions, and made us feel welcome automatically. We knew this was the venue we wanted for our wedding within the first ten minutes of being there! Our original wedding was scheduled for May 2020. Of course, due to COVID our original date didn't happen. I was so upset to make that decision in March but Kaylee and the Ballroom were fantastic. The were understanding, they kept in contact, and when it came time we had no issues postponing and changing our date. We rescheduled for July 2020 with a severely shortened guest list. I had to make changes as soon as the week before our wedding date. Kaylee made sure all of our needs were taken care of. She was conscious about social distancing, about sanitation, and keeping me in the loop. I am forever grateful for her and her team. Planning a wedding is stressful enough but I was really feeling the pressure tenfold in those closing months! Our wedding day went off perfectly. I stayed in the Suite the night before and let me tell you, that bed will make even the most nervous bride sleep peacefully! The venue needs little help in the way of decor, it's naturally gorgeous. The staff on site was polite and helpful. At the end of the night the security even helped us bring a few things out! There are a LOT of stairs at this venue but they have an elevator that works great and made things MUCH easier in setting up and breaking down. The surrounding area of Downtown Macon has tons of opportunities for pictures if you want a change of scenery for a few. Honestly, despite the challenges of 2020, my wedding day is something I will look back on with overwhelming joy and that is in large part thanks to The Library Ballroom. If you want a beautiful venue with a warm staff that really cares about YOU, I say book today. I cannot recommend them enough!
